Join our team as a Machinist!
 
The Machinist I is responsible for creating prototype machined parts on CNC Milling machines. The role will also create computer program for the CNC machines using Mastercam and do set up to run multiple parts if needed.
 
Shift: 3pm-11pm
  • Set up CNC milling or CNC lathe machines and run parts as needed.
  • Responsible for quick turnaround of parts and accuracy within established guidelines.
  • Safety and maintenance of machining area.
  • Run jobs on CNC milling and CNC lathe machines ensuring all parts meet tight manufacturing requirements.
  • Prepare CAM files from various sources to include CAD files, prints, and verbal instruction.
  • Plan and set up jobs for CNC milling and CNC lathe equipment.
  • Maintain organization of jobs and material inventory.
  • Perform cleaning and general maintenance on milling or lathe machines and general shop equipment.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.
  • High School Diploma or equivalent.
  • 2+ years experience as a CNC Milling or CNC lathe machine operator preferred doing setup and some understanding of programming
  • Able to read blueprints, Use of SolidWorks and Mastercam.
  • Self-starter capable of dealing with a variety of tasks in a fast paced, multi-tasking environment
  • Ability to solve problems that arise in a manufacturing environment without direct supervision while also performing as part of a team.
  • Ability to manage time and prioritize work in an effective manner.
  • Knowledge of Machining in a prototype manufacturing setting or related experience and education.
  • High standard of attention to detail.
  • Basic level of Microsoft Office Suite, (Outlook, Word, Excel)

  • Proto Labs maintains ITAR-compliant operations in all of our United States based facilities.  Due to ITAR regulations, this role is only open to U.S. Citizens, lawful permanent residents (green card holders) or foreign nationals granted refugee or asylee status.  Individuals with temporary visas (e.g. E, F-1, H-1, H-2, L, B, J, TN or OPT) are not eligible for hire in this role.

    Physical Demands:
    While performing the essential duties of this job, the employee is occasionally required to sit; use a computer keyboard, monitor and mouse, telephone and printer; reach with hands, and arms, talk, see and hear.  The employee is regularly required to stand, walk, stoop or kneel and must be able to lift and/or move up to 70 pounds. 

    Work Environment:
    Indoors (A/C); nonsmoking; the majority of this job function is performed in a manufacturing area exposed to machinery and noise; with eye protection and safety shoes required. Occasionally works in outside weather conditions. Occasionally works near moving mechanical parts and in high, precarious places and is occasionally exposed to wet and/or humid conditions, fumes or airborne particles, toxic or caustic chemicals, risk of electrical shock and vibration. The noise level in the work environment is usually quiet to moderate.
